AL-HIKMAH: Jurnal Theosofi dan Peradaban Islam is a peer-reviewed academic journal, established in 2013 as part of the Aqidah dan Filsafat Islam of Faculty of Ushuluddin and Islamic Studies of UIN Sumatera Utara Medan. AL-HIKMAH is dedicated to the publication of scholarly articles in various branches of Islamic Studies, by which exchanges of ideas as research findings is facilitated. AL-HIKMAH welcomes contributions of articles is such fields as Quranic Studies, Prophetic Traditions, Theology, Philosophy, Law and Economics, History, Islamic Education.

Although there are some variations, excavations from several sources reveal at least four series of rituals carried out in the tariqa including: First, Baiat, is a process of saying the pledge of allegiance to practice all the knowledge and teachings of the tariqa given. Second, tawajjuh "sitting face to face", an assessment process carried out by spiritual guides to determine the level of readiness and ability of students to accept the transformation of religious science. Third, dhikr / nafus / suluk, although there are slight differences, but these three rituals contain the practice of a series of spiritual rituals for the purpose of purifying the heart before receiving knowledge transfer from the spiritual guide. Fourth, khataman, completes the entire series of rituals at all levels from the lowest level to the highest with the opinion of full assistance from the spiritual guide.  The method used by the leader of the Babussalam Baru Sei Titi An-Nur hut in Huta Baru Village, uses habituation and advice methods. The Umayyad dynasty (661-750 AD) was an important milestone in the early history of Islamic civilization that underwent a major transformation from an elective caliphate system to a centralized hereditary monarchy. This research aims to examine historically the transformation of power and cultural policies during the Umayyad period, especially related to Arabization, Islamization, and the role of Damascus as the center of Islamic civilization. The method used is a qualitative-descriptive approach with literature study techniques from relevant sources. The results showed that the Arabization policy, which included the uniformity of administrative language and bureaucratic system, played a major role in building the political and cultural unity of Muslims. Meanwhile, the Islamization process expanded the influence of Islam to Asia, Africa and Europe, as well as creating social dynamics between Arab and non-Arab Muslims (mawali). Damascus developed into a cosmopolite cultural center through the acculturation of Arabic, Byzantine and Persian cultures. This transformation laid the foundation for an inclusive and multicultural global Islamic civilization.

Tariqah, as part of the Sufi tradition, plays a significant role in fostering religious moderation within pluralistic societies. Beyond serving as an individual spiritual practice, tariqah functions as a social space that transmits ethical and moderate religious values. A qualitative approach was employed through literature review and empirical observation of tariqah practices and the role of mursyids in socio-religious life. The analysis focused on the internalization of Sufi values, the dynamics of mursyid roles, and variations in their doctrinal orientations. Values such as balance, self-discipline, compassion, and rejection of extremism are internalized through rituals, religious education, and community activities. Mursyids act as both spiritual guides and social agents who shape followers’ religious orientation and mediate the implementation of moderation. The diversity among mursyids ranging from moderate-adaptive, traditional-conservative, to highly modern demonstrates that tariqah is a dynamic tradition capable of maintaining its Sufi essence while responding to social change. Consequently, tariqah contributes significantly to strengthening religious moderation and social harmony through the integration of spiritual and social dimensions.

This study explores Hasan Hanafi’s hermeneutics as a contemporary approach to interpreting Islam in response to the challenges of modernity. The rapid development of modern social, political, and cultural dynamics requires an interpretive methodology that goes beyond textual literalism and emphasizes contextual understanding. Hasan Hanafi develops a critical emancipatory hermeneutics that positions human beings as active subjects in interpreting revelation, integrating Islamic intellectual tradition, phenomenology, Marxism, and Western hermeneutics. His hermeneutical framework is built through three levels of consciousness historical, eidetic, and practical aimed at transforming religious texts into a source of social liberation and renewal. This research employs a qualitative method through literature study to analyze Hanafi’s ideas comprehensively. The findings indicate that Hanafi’s hermeneutics serves 006Eot only as a way to understand the text, but also as a transformative paradigm that bridges Islamic tradition with modernity, offering relevant solutions to contemporary issues faced by the Muslim world.

Muhammad Arkoun’s Qur’anic hermeneutics offers a critical and transformative framework capable of reopening Islamic religious discourses long confined by orthodox exclusivity. This article examines the epistemological foundations of Arkoun’s hermeneutical project, particularly his concepts of double reading, the distinction between the Qur’anic phenomenon and the closed official corpus, as well as the trilateral structure of the thinkable– unthinkable–unthought. Through these theoretical pillars, Arkoun attempts to deconstruct the established structures of religious authority while formulating possibilities for renewing the study of Islamic theology and philosophy. This study shows that Arkoun’s interdisciplinary approach combining historicism, social anthropology, linguistics, and post-structuralist philosophy provides a revolutionary methodological apparatus for reinterpreting the foundations of Islamic theology. The article argues that Arkoun’s hermeneutics not only critiques the tradition but also offers an epistemological reconstruction for contemporary studies in Islamic creed and philosophy. The findings demonstrate that Arkoun’s intellectual contribution opens new conceptual spaces for reorienting Islamic religious studies from doctrinal-normative frameworks toward critical, reflective, historical, and transformative discourse analysis.
